Transaction d592aefa8420297217296a1daa3bcde008b5b231a07cf3bdde00d2183e8b6b89
1 Input
1 Output
-
d592aefa8420297217296a1daa3bcde008b5b231a07cf3bdde00d2183e8b6b89:0
- value
- 16982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ddb0b71b22e8f23f5c57987c0bf65b451ca0ee OP_EQUAL
- address
- 3MThTHpTuJcQ4VoyKANMBJHQ82BPhjte9m